Ritual Learning Method for Mystical Ijazah at "Pondok Pesantren Salafiyah"
Sholahuddin Al Ayubi; Muhammad Masruri
Journal of Education and Learning (EduLearn), v19 n1 p314-321 2025
"Pondok pesantren salafiyah" (Islamic school) is an Islamic educational institution known for its traditional approach to Islam. The teaching of mystical science in "pondok pesantren salafiyah" includes the use of mystical "ijazah" (certification) and ritual learning methods, providing students with a unique education. This study's main focus is exploring the learning methods, processes, understanding, and ritual methods of mystical diplomas applied by "kiai" (leader of Islamic boarding school). This study aims to understand more deeply how this mystical ritual is taught and how it contributes to the spiritual development of students in "salafi" boarding schools. This research uses qualitative research techniques, participant observation, interviews, and document analysis. The results showed that practicing mystical rituals involves reading sacred texts (yellow book), "riyadah" (meditation), symbolic movements, and physical exercise. This contributes to the spiritual development of students and their introduction to mystical teachings. The research also highlights "pesantren's" unique approach to combining mystical teachings with traditional Islamic education, which supports a deeper understanding of spirituality. In addition, this study also discusses the challenges and opportunities faced by Islamic educational institutions in preserving and adapting ritual learning methods in the modern era.
